Once a student is done chalking out a plan regarding the adjustment problems and about the courses, VISA and the budget, they need to shift their focus on the accommodation issue. The Indian students or for that matter any international student in USA has three main options regarding the accommodations.
One is on-campus dormitories, another is off-campus apartments and the third one is homestays.
Most US institutions send their students an orientation package to help them and especially in case of international students they give accommodations options. The on-campus dormitories are usually helpful for the new students as they do not need an access to a car for the commute to the institution in this way and also because they get an active social life. The meal plans in these places are most of the time very flexible making it easier for the new students to settle in.
In some cases on-campus living facilities are quite expensive and on some cases they are not there. That is where off-campus facilities come in which mainly include renting an apartment and sharing it with a roommate. While choosing a place to stay it is important to take care of the location as a place very far from the campus is highly undesirable especially since an Indian student is unlikely to get a car.
Homestays are a good option for them who are unsure about living alone in a new country as this will allow them to live with an American family. This too needs to be close to the institution campus. Homestays are usually the best way for a student to truly soak in the American culture and enjoy it.
